the MHRA advises checking vitamin B12 levels if deficiency is suspected and considering periodic monitoring in those with risk factors [6] Chronic alcohol consumption can damage the gastric mucosa and impair absorption Nitrous oxide exposure (including recreational use) can inactivate vitamin B12 in the body, causing functional deficiency and neurological symptoms If you experience symptoms such as unexplained fatigue, pale skin, shortness of breath, neurological symptoms (tingling, numbness, balance problems), mood changes, or cognitive difficulties, contact your GP promptly
This can happen gradually, so you may not notice the signs right away
